1. What do scrap metal removal services include?
These services involve the collection, hauling, and proper disposal or recycling of unwanted metal items from residential, commercial, or industrial properties.
2. What types of metal do scrap removal services accept?
Most services accept ferrous metals (like steel and iron) and non-ferrous metals (such as aluminum, copper, brass, and stainless steel).
3. How do I schedule scrap metal removal?
You can usually schedule removal by contacting the service provider directly via phone or their website; some offer same-day or scheduled pickups.
4. Is there typically a cost for scrap metal removal?
Costs vary; some companies charge fees based on volume or weight, while others may pay you for valuable metals depending on market rates.
5. How should I prepare scrap metal for removal?
It's helpful to sort metals by type if possible and remove non-metal attachments; some services may provide guidance on acceptable materials.
